No Hand Signals

Introduction

One role of London Councils is to help promote private legislation on behalf of the boroughs. The 9th London Local Authorities Bill received Royal Assent in July, becoming the LLA Act 2007.

Local Environmental Quality in Times of Austerity, 2011 research

  • By admin

London Councils co-funded research with Keep Britain Tidy in 2011 to explore London residents’ priorities for council spending. It investigates where local environmental quality and related anti-social behaviour issues feature amongst broader public priorities and asks why local environment quality is consistently a priority.
